First-Line Supervisor of Gaming Worker Salary in Kansas City, Missouri

The annual salary statistics of first-line supervisors of gaming workers in Kansas City, Missouri is shown in Table 1. The wage statistics of first-line supervisors of gaming workers in Kansas City is based on the national compensation survey conducted by the U.S. Bureau of Labor Statistics in 2022 and published in April 2023 [1].

Table 1. Annual Salary of First-Line Supervisors of Gaming Workers in Kansas City, Missouri

Percentile BracketAverage Annual Salary
10th Percentile Wage
$34,540
25th Percentile Wage
$41,970
50th Percentile Wage
$48,500
75th Percentile Wage
$57,680
90th Percentile Wage
$64,520

Table 1 shows the average annual salary for first-line supervisors of gaming workers in Kansas City, Missouri in 5 percentile scales. The average annual salary for the 90th percentile (the top 10 percent of the highest paid) is $64,520. The median (50th percentile) annual salary is $48,500. The average annual salary for the bottom 10 percent earners is $34,540.

Table 2. Compare First-Line Supervisor of Gaming Worker Salary in Kansas City with Other Missouri Cities

From Table 3 we note that with a median annual salary of $48,500, Kansas City is the highest paying city for first-line supervisors of gaming workers in state of Missouri, followed by St Louis (median annual salary $48,030). In comparison, the median annual salary of first-line supervisors of gaming workers in Kansas City is 1.0 percent (1.0%) higher than that in St Louis.

Cities/Areas Median Annual Salary
Kansas City
$48,500
St Louis
$48,030
